Output ecfb9d94e5008798d4a683c157870a1af0d3ba0b8dfce4a1c479f567908fbc0c:0

value
26400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b4c2f83db40291440398a650f555318538ee071 OP_EQUAL
address
32ikd84bRk3M1jx9rJuqQmR3nU7AV1DApj
transaction
ecfb9d94e5008798d4a683c157870a1af0d3ba0b8dfce4a1c479f567908fbc0c
spent
true